Li Lu created YARN-3292:
---------------------------
Summary: [Umbrella] Tests and/or tools for YARN backwards
compatibility verification
Key: YARN-3292
URL: https://issues.apache.org/jira/browse/YARN-3292
Project: Hadoop YARN
Issue Type: Improvement
Reporter: Li Lu
Assignee: Li Lu
YARN-666 added the support to YARN rolling upgrade. In order to support this
feature, we made changes from many perspectives. There were many assumptions
made together with these existing changes. Future code changes may break these
assumptions by accident, and hence break the YARN rolling upgrades feature.
To simplify YARN RU regression tests, maybe we would like to create a set of
tools/tests that can verify YARN RU backward compatibility.
On the very first step, we may want to have a compatibility checker for
important protocols and APIs. We may also want to incorporate these tools into
our test Jenkins runs, if necessary.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)